Course summary

Develop your knowledge, understanding, critical-thinking and problem-solving in areas required by modern international business organisations.

  • Gain a globally focused grounding in accounting and financial management, delivered in the heart of the City of London.
  • Develop your knowledge of world economies and development, international investment, and business management, from a finance and accounting perspective.
  • Learn how to give sound financial advice and make effective financial decisions.
Why you should study this course: Fast-track to a degree Fast-track your way to a bachelor's degree in accounting and finance with this intensive one-year course, designed for learners holding level 5 qualifications in finance or accountancy-related fields. ACCA, CIMA and ICAEW accreditation The Accounting and Finance for International Business (Top-Up) BA (Hons) has been accredited by ACCA, CIMA and ICAEW. Industry standard technology You’ll learn to use leading accounting, trading and research technologies including Bloomberg Terminals and our S&P Market Intelligence Suite. London location Our campus is based in the heart of the City of London, a leading financial hub and one of the world’s premier business locations. Prepare for your future You will emerge from the course with well-developed skills of analysis, clear perspectives on financial strategy and strategic thinking, and highly effective communication and research skills, all of which are demanded by employers in the accounting and finance sectors.

Modules

Your main study themes are:

  • Internationalisation You’ll learn to apply your skills internationally, whether working for a multi-national, dealing with overseas companies, trading globally, or moving money around the world.
  • Frameworks You’ll deepen your understanding of a wide range of governance systems, including business ethics; international accounting standards; and legal and regulatory frameworks.
  • The use of information You’ll learn to accurately gather, record, analyse, model and present key financial information, both for internal and external use, within the appropriate frameworks.
  • Business strategy You will contextualise finance and accounting within wider business and economics, and explore the way business strategy depends on, and also influences, financial and accounting policy and results.

Entry requirements

Qualification requirements

HND or successful completion of 2 years appropriate academic study in Higher Education. All applications are considered on an individual basis and the whole application is reviewed which includes previous and predicted qualifications, experience, reference and your motivation to study the course.
